a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orDaniel Dragomir <daniel.dragomir@windriver.com>2018-12-07 12:38:00 +0200
committerArmin Kuster <akuster808@gmail.com>2018-12-15 15:03:07 -0800
commita9d447316404bcd1f62ff00534e1bc825dd8405a (patch)
tree10e637148bb2a131e9c579332b697bf1ff2d42ba
parenta41f3b242fed57632960c97a5d130fa6130ee21a (diff)
downloadmeta-security-a9d447316404bcd1f62ff00534e1bc825dd8405a.tar.gz
meta-security-a9d447316404bcd1f62ff00534e1bc825dd8405a.tar.bz2
meta-security-a9d447316404bcd1f62ff00534e1bc825dd8405a.zip
tpm2.0-tss: Remove resourcemgr sub-package
Since in 2.0.x branch resourcemgr was removed as deprecated by commit 7966ef8916f79ed09eab966a58d773f413fbb67f ("Remove resourcemgr and fixup build.") and commit 0e175d36c13b1801d75ae768ac520154585326f8 ("contrib: Remove systemd service and udev rules for old resourcemgr."), remove resourcemgr sub-package with it's components. Build will fail when trying sed command on resourcemgr.service (No such file or directory). Signed-off-by: Daniel Dragomir <daniel.dragomir@windriver.com> Signed-off-by: Armin Kuster <akuster808@gmail.com>
-rw-r--r--meta-tpm/recipes-tpm/tpm2.0-tss/tpm2.0-tss_2.0.1.bb19
1 files changed, 0 insertions, 19 deletions
diff --git a/meta-tpm/recipes-tpm/tpm2.0-tss/tpm2.0-tss_2.0.1.bb b/meta-tpm/recipes-tpm/tpm2.0-tss/tpm2.0-tss_2.0.1.bb
index 3e7b81a..9d1ff72 100644
--- a/meta-tpm/recipes-tpm/tpm2.0-tss/tpm2.0-tss_2.0.1.bb
+++ b/meta-tpm/recipes-tpm/tpm2.0-tss/tpm2.0-tss_2.0.1.bb
@@ -24,22 +24,6 @@ EXTRA_USERS_PARAMS = "\
groupadd tss; \
"
-SYSTEMD_PACKAGES = "resourcemgr"
-SYSTEMD_SERVICE_resourcemgr = "resourcemgr.service"
-SYSTEMD_AUTO_ENABLE_resourcemgr = "enable"
-
-do_patch[postfuncs] += "${@bb.utils.contains('VIRTUAL-RUNTIME_init_manager','systemd','fix_systemd_unit','', d)}"
-fix_systemd_unit () {
- sed -i -e 's;^ExecStart=.*/resourcemgr;ExecStart=${sbindir}/resourcemgr;' ${S}/contrib/resourcemgr.service
-}
-
-do_install_append() {
- if ${@bb.utils.contains('DISTRO_FEATURES','systemd','true','false',d)}; then
- install -d ${D}${systemd_system_unitdir}
- install -m0644 ${S}/contrib/resourcemgr.service ${D}${systemd_system_unitdir}/resourcemgr.service
- fi
-}
-
PROVIDES = "${PACKAGES}"
PACKAGES = " \
${PN} \
@@ -57,7 +41,6 @@ PACKAGES = " \
libtss2 \
libtss2-dev \
libtss2-staticdev \
- resourcemgr \
"
FILES_libtss2-tcti-device = "${libdir}/libtss2-tcti-device.so.*"
@@ -89,5 +72,3 @@ FILES_libtss2-dev = " \
FILES_libtss2-staticdev = "${libdir}/libtss*a"
FILES_${PN} = "${libdir}/udev"
-
-FILES_resourcemgr = "${sbindir}/resourcemgr ${systemd_system_unitdir}/resourcemgr.service"